Destiny's Child was an American R and B and pop group active from 1990 to 2005. Originally consisting of Beyoncé Knowles, Kelly Rowland, LaTavia Roberson, and LeToya Luckett, the group achieved international fame in the late 1990s with hits like «No, No, No» and «Say My Name». After a series of lineup changes, Destiny's Child became a trio composed of Beyoncé Knowles, Kelly Rowland, and Michelle Williams. Their 2001 album, *Survivor*, sold over 10 million copies worldwide and cemented their status as one of the most influential pop bands. Other hits include «Independent Women Part I», «Bootylicious» and «Lose My Breath». Destiny's Child disbanded in 2005, leaving a significant musical legacy that has inspired generations of artists.
